Dr Joshua Berkowitz, founder of the IV Boost Clinic said: “Vitamin D is one of many vitamins essential for our health. It plays an important role in helping our bodies absorb calcium which is needed to form healthy bones.

“It also helps strengthen our immune system, fight off viruses and battle fatigue. Increasingly, it’s been linked to good mood – with a vitamin D deficiency associated with anxiety and depression.”

“Other common symptoms of Vitamin D deficiency are fatigue (a feeling of constant tiredness), always catching coughs and colds and aches and pains in muscles and joints.”
